diff options
Diffstat (limited to 'src/mongo/util/concurrency/ticketholder.h')
-rw-r--r-- | src/mongo/util/concurrency/ticketholder.h |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/mongo/util/concurrency/ticketholder.h b/src/mongo/util/concurrency/ticketholder.h index 6eb66bbc0b5..45a068d45ce 100644 --- a/src/mongo/util/concurrency/ticketholder.h +++ b/src/mongo/util/concurrency/ticketholder.h @@ -53,8 +53,8 @@ class TicketHolder { friend class Ticket; public: - TicketHolder(int32_t numTickets, ServiceContext* svcCtx) - : _outof(numTickets), _serviceContext(svcCtx){}; + TicketHolder(int32_t numTickets, ServiceContext* svcCtx); + virtual ~TicketHolder(){}; /** @@ -191,6 +191,7 @@ private: AtomicWord<int32_t> _outof; AtomicWord<int32_t> _peakUsed; AtomicWord<std::int64_t> _immediatePriorityAdmissionsCount; + bool _usingDynamicConcurrencyAdjustment; protected: /** |